Title :
Robust partitioning for reliable real-time systems
Author :
Seyer, Reinhard ; Siemers, Christian ; Falsett, Rainer ; Ecker, Klaus ; Richter, Harald
Author_Institution :
DaimlerChrysler Res., Germany
Abstract :
Summary form only given. Mechatronic systems request for high reliability, especially in the context of time where mostly hard real-time capabilities are mandatory. May be even stronger requirements regard the robustness against software failures and interdependences from erroneous tasks to others. We propose the concept of robust partitioning for reliable real-time embedded systems. The concept consists of two parts, memory space protection and time protection. Memory protection is realized by already existing hardware and software mechanisms. For realizing temporal protection, a two-step timer interrupt system realizing an imprecise computation concept is proposed: if the execution of a module exceeds a certain time limit before the deadline, the first timer interrupt is triggered and a backup routine is started to produce an imprecise result in the remaining time until the second timer expires. This time protection concept shows significant advantages as compared to classical approaches for single, parallel and distributed systems. We give an extended introduction into the concept and discussed first attempts for its realization.
Keywords :
embedded systems; interrupts; mechatronics; software reliability; embedded system; mechatronic system; memory space protection; reliable real-time system partitioning; time protection; two-step timer interrupt system; Communication system control; Control systems; Embedded software; Embedded system; Hardware; Mechatronics; Protection; Real time systems; Robustness; Timing;
Conference_Titel :
Parallel and Distributed Processing Symposium, 2004. Proceedings. 18th International
Print_ISBN :
0-7695-2132-0
DOI :
10.1109/IPDPS.2004.1303073